Why plastic fencings fall short here greater than elsewhere
Vinyl is durable, yet it has vulnerable points that regional problems exploit.
The wind is the initial offender. The stress from a 40 mile-per-hour gust on a six-foot personal privacy panel is no joke, and the channel messages that hold the panel can bend or split if the rails are not appropriately locked. Fencings along large streets like Edinger or near open great deals often tend to see more panel blowouts because there is much less to slow the wind. The Santa Ana winds that move below the canyons each fall dry out the air and make plastic more weak for a time, after that struck it with a push.
UV exposure is the second. South and west dealing with runs discolor faster, obtain hairline fractures at stress and anxiety points, and are much more vulnerable to chalking. White plastic does best, darker colors absorb even more warm and show distortion around screws or braces. The UV index right here consistently hits 8 to 10 in summer season, which speeds up oxidation on inexpensive formulations that do not have sufficient titanium dioxide.
Moisture plays a quieter duty. Watering overspray from pop-up sprinklers or drip lines that leak along the fencing line can blemish articles with tough water identifying, invite algae, and fill the soil around grounds. Plastic itself does not rot, but the concrete that supports your articles can loosen as damp dirt expands and dries. In backyards with heavy clay or backfill, you see leaning articles and heaving panels after a wet winter.
Then there is hardware. Gates represent a huge part of vinyl fence repair calls in Santa Ana. The messages are hollow and need inner support, generally an aluminum or steel insert, to hold joint lag screws. When the contractor misses that, an entrance that swings lots of times a day will certainly draw the bolts loose in 2 to 3 years. Include a child hanging on it, or a gardener that leans a blower on it, and the sag shows up fast.
What a premier technician searches for on the first visit
An excellent professional does not simply tape a fracture and drive off. The first ten mins set the tone for the entire job.
They start by strolling the run, noting the wind exposure, grade modifications, watering heads, and any trees close to the fencing. They check for plumb with an easy degree, try the gate for play at the latch, and look under the lower rail for clearance. A fence that sits too low drags out high areas and will certainly snap clips. They glide the leading rail a little if possible. If it does hold one's ground, it might be glued, which is a red flag because glued rails catch development and result in anxiety cracks.
Then comes the hardware. Joints need to have heavy scale screws right into a strengthened message, not right into raw vinyl. Latches must line up without you needing to lift eviction. A great tech likewise asks about the fencing's age and brand name. If you have leftover components or a warranty card from a well established producer, matching accounts and color is simpler and costs less.
Finally, a fast conversation about property lines and the city. Fencing repairs at the existing height and area typically do not need permits in Santa Ana, but if the damages is along a shared line or you plan to transform elevation or style, the regulations change. A professional service will certainly not play fast and loose with obstacles, and they need to encourage you to loophole in your next-door neighbor prior to job starts.
The most usual vinyl fencing repair work and how they are fixed
Cracked pickets happen where a weed leaner strikes the lower edge or where a sphere strikes the midspan. The best fix is to open the top rail, slide out the split picket, and slide in a coordinating replacement. On older fencings with fragile rails, the technology might need to cut and change a section of rail too. Quick caulking is a bandage at finest, and it will certainly yellow.
Panel blowouts are regular after a gusty night. You will see the tongue-and-groove pickets splayed, the bottom rail bowed, or one end of the panel bulged of the post. The repair work is to re-seat the panel, commonly replacing damaged U-channels, lower rail clips, or finish caps. If the message has cracked at the directed openings, it may need a sleeve or complete substitute with brand-new concrete. When panels stand out numerous times along the very same run, the solution usually includes including aluminum rail support to cut flex.
Leaning blog posts signify a ground issue. In several system homes, plastic messages were embeded in 8 to 10 inches of concrete because the installer was racing the clock. In wind passages, a six-foot fence needs larger, deeper grounds, commonly 12 inches broad and 24 inches deep, with compressed base. A correct repair work includes carefully extracting the blog post, eliminating loosened concrete, re-drilling to depth, and resetting with fresh concrete that crowns over grade so water sheds.
Gate sag and lock imbalance can be repaired without restoring the whole entrance. The technology look for a metal insert in the hinge blog post, changes stripped lag screws with through-bolts where possible, and mounts an adjustable joint set that enables fine tuning. A diagonal brace inside eviction structure might be included in move weight to the joint side. If eviction structure itself is racked, a rebuild with strengthened rails is the straightforward call.
Scuffs, spots, and liquid chalking ask for cleaning, not repaint. A soft brush, a bucket of warm water with a little meal soap, and a magic eraser manage most grime. For algae or mildew along unethical runs, a diluted oxygen bleach functions. Avoid acetone or rough solvents, which can haze the surface area. For iron spots from sprinkler water, a gentle oxalic acid cleaner, used sparingly, lifts the orange without etching.
Matching parts and shade so the repair disappears
Nothing ruins a repair service much faster than a brilliant white picket in a fence that has mellowed to lotion. Plastic does fade a shade or more in time. An experienced vinyl fence repair business in Santa Ana carries swatches from typical manufacturers and recognizes the accounts that neighborhood building contractors utilized in the 2000s and 2010s. Even when the initial brand name is unknown, a close suit is possible by focusing on gloss degree, groove width, and cap style.
For structural parts, aluminum rail inserts are a peaceful upgrade that will not change the appearance however will maintain a repaired period straight in the wind. On gateways, changing from asset hinges to stainless or powder-coated steel lowers squeaking and the sluggish drift of placement that drives people crazy.
Cost, timelines, and what drives both
Most single-issue vinyl fence repair calls, like a split picket or a stood out panel, fall in the 200 to 450 buck range in Santa Ana when components are easily available and accessibility is clear. Entrance rehanging with brand-new hinges and lock runs 300 to 600 relying on whether the hinge article requires support. Leaning message resets typically start around 350 for one article and range up by 200 to 300 for each and every added blog post because a lot of the moment remains in setup and concrete work.
Complex wind damages with several articles and numerous panels can get to 1,200 to 2,500, specifically if matching components need to be unique purchased. Lead time on unusual accounts ranges from 2 days to two weeks. After a major wind occasion, good business triage calls, maintain the most awful failings first, after that circle back to finish visual solutions. That line up can add a day or two.
Two elements turn price more than any type of others. Access allows. If the technology can wheel a mixer or bring in concrete near the job, labor remains low. If they need to hand-carry via a tight side lawn, the task takes longer. The 2nd is what exists under your fencing line. Tree origins, old footings, or hidden irrigation lines slow excavation and elevate risk. A pro will certainly penetrate initial and established expectations.
Repair or change, and exactly how to make a decision with a clear head
Vinyl fence fixing makes good sense if the problems are localized and the rest of the fence is audio. 2 or 3 damaged pickets, one leaning article, or a cranky gateway do not justify a full substitute. When damage extends throughout long runs, or when the vinyl itself is brittle throughout, replacement may be smarter.
Age is a clue, not a decision. I have seen 18-year-old fences that tidy up fresh since they were installed with appropriate reinforcements and avoided overspray. I have likewise cut out seven-year-old panels that shattered like glass because a deal brand was made use of. Check a surprise area with modest pressure. If a level screwdriver pushed gently right into a surface develops a crawler crack, the vinyl has lost way too many plasticizers and is near the end of its valuable life.
Budget issues, however so does interruption. Complete substitute transforms a yard for a week, with demolition, hauling, and allows if you transform anything about elevation or line. A well intended round of vinyl fence repair in Santa Ana can restore function and tidy appearance in a day while you keep your weekend breaks free.
HOA rules, property lines, and keeping neighbors friendly
Santa Ana has a lot of neighborhoods with HOAs that control fencing shade and design. Lots of define white or tan, a particular cap, and an optimum height at street-facing edges. Changing areas like-for-like seldom sets off formal approval, but if you remain in a rigorous organization, send out a fast e-mail with a sketch or image before work beginnings. It soothes dispute later.
Property lines can be refined. Lots of fences rest a few inches inside truth line to stay clear of disagreements. If you are not sure the fence is your own, pull the survey pins with a metal detector or inspect shutting papers. A fencing precisely on the line typically belongs jointly to both neighbors, which implies a common price for significant repair work. When eviction is the only problem
Gates fall short in a different way from panels. The weight concentrates at the joint post and wants to draw it out of plumb. Begin there. Strengthen the message internally, upgrade the joint readied to an adjustable style with stainless pins, and set the gate so the lock fulfills cleanly without lift. If kids or pets push hard on the lock, a demonstrator with a larger catch zone provides you resistance. Self-closing joints, called for around pools, need fine adjusting to meet code and avoid slamming. A little perseverance here settles with silent operation for years.

Emergency stabilization after a wind event
When a panel burn out or a message leans hazardously, a few measured actions will certainly protect against additional damages while you await help.
- Turn off lawn sprinklers that soak the area near the failure so the footing does not soften more. Use a number of timber stakes and a band to brace a leaning message back towards plumb, placing the risks in undisturbed soil. Pick up and pile loose pickets and caps in the color to avoid bending in direct sun. If a gateway will certainly not latch, remove the latch striker momentarily and secure eviction gathered a rope to a secure anchor. Keep family pets and children away from the location, especially from panels that are partly unseated and might fall.
These are substitutes, not fixings. They get time and restriction collateral breakage while you await a crew.
Maintenance that expands the life of your fixed fence
Vinyl is reduced maintenance, yet not no upkeep. Two times a year, provide the fence a fast clean. A tube, a soft brush, and mild soap keep surface area crud from embedding. Consider including splash guards to irrigation heads that are also close to the fence, or angle them somewhat. Cut vines early prior to they root into channels. Leave a one-inch gap at the bottom rail when you include mulch so the fencing does not touch constantly wet soil.
If you see little problems, act early. A top rail that hums in the wind today is a blown panel following month. A lock that catches only if you lift the gate is a loose hinge planned. The repair after damage expenses more than a tune up ahead of time.

Real-world examples from around Santa Ana
A home owner near McFadden and Harbor called after an agitated evening of wind left 3 panels bowed. The fencing was only 6 years of ages, yet the bottom rail clips were the light-duty type. We added light weight aluminum inserts to the leading and lower rails throughout the windward run, replaced the damaged clips with a stronger profile, and reset one message with a much deeper footing. The repair service vanished aesthetically, and the following wind occasion left the fencing quiet.
In an older community off Flower Street, a dual gateway dragged so badly the owner had actually quit utilizing the side yard. The hinge posts were hollow, with lag screws hardly attacking. We sleeved both blog posts with light weight aluminum inserts, through-bolted new stainless hinges, and added a diagonal brace vinyl fence repair company santa ana Fence Menders per fallen leave. The lock now hits cleanly also on hot days when the plastic expands.
A service near Bristol had actually fence panels caked with tough water from a mis-aimed lawn sprinkler. The owner feared replacement. A careful cleaning with a soft brush and a thin down oxalic remedy brought back the surface, adhered to by resetting 2 pickets that had actually loosened up at the tongue. That fixing set you back a tiny fraction of new panels and kept the tenants happy.

Frequently Ask Questions about Vinyl Fence Repair
How to fix a vinyl fence piece?
To fix a vinyl fence piece, first identify the damaged section. Small cracks or holes can be repaired using vinyl repair kits or epoxy. For broken panels, replacement pieces may be necessary, which often snap into the existing posts. Ensure the fence is clean and dry before applying repair materials.
What's the life expectancy of a vinyl fence?
Vinyl fences typically last 20 to 30 years with proper maintenance. Life expectancy depends on climate, quality of materials, and exposure to sunlight. Regular cleaning and avoiding physical damage can extend lifespan. Higher-quality vinyl products generally last longer than budget options.
Are vinyl fences hard to repair?
Vinyl fences are relatively easy to repair for minor cracks or scratches using repair kits or adhesives. Major damage, such as broken panels or posts, usually requires replacement pieces. Repairs are simpler than with wood since vinyl does not rot or require painting. Some repairs may require disassembly of adjacent panels.
What is the average price of a vinyl fence?
The average cost of a vinyl fence ranges from $20 to $40 per linear foot, depending on height, style, and quality. Installation costs vary and can increase the overall expense. Custom designs or high-end materials may cost more. Vinyl fencing is typically more expensive upfront than wood but requires less maintenance over time.
Can you repair a hole in vinyl?
Yes, small holes in vinyl can be repaired using vinyl patch kits, epoxy, or adhesive. The area should be cleaned and dried before applying the repair material. For larger holes, replacement panels may be more effective. Sanding or smoothing may be necessary to match the surface texture.
Can I use PVC glue on a vinyl fence?
PVC glue is not recommended for all vinyl fences because vinyl and PVC may have different chemical compositions. Using the correct vinyl adhesive or epoxy designed for outdoor vinyl is safer. Always check the manufacturer’s recommendations. Using incompatible glue can weaken the bond and cause failure.
What holds a vinyl fence up?
Vinyl fences are supported by posts, which are usually anchored in concrete for stability. Panels attach to these posts using brackets or rails. Proper installation and spacing are key for structural integrity. The posts bear most of the wind and weight stress on the fence.
What are the downsides of vinyl fencing?
Downsides of vinyl fencing include higher upfront cost compared to wood, potential discoloration from prolonged sun exposure, and brittleness in extreme cold. Repairs can be tricky if panels are severely damaged. Vinyl fences can also warp or crack under heavy impact. Some homeowners may prefer the natural aesthetic of wood.
What lasts longer, a wood fence or a vinyl fence?
Vinyl fences generally last longer than wood fences, often 20–30 years versus 10–15 years for wood. Vinyl is resistant to rot, insect damage, and weathering. Wood may require staining or sealing to extend its life. Properly maintained wood can approach vinyl’s lifespan but usually requires more ongoing maintenance.
Is it possible to fix a scratched vinyl?
Yes, minor scratches on vinyl can be repaired using a vinyl repair kit, heat, or a rubbing compound designed for plastics. Deep scratches may require replacement of the affected panel. Cleaning the area first ensures better adhesion or smoothing. Light scratches may also fade over time with sun exposure.
Will vinegar ruin a vinyl fence?
Vinegar is generally safe for cleaning vinyl fences in diluted form, but undiluted vinegar or frequent use can dull the surface. Always rinse the fence thoroughly after cleaning. Mild soap and water are typically safer for regular maintenance. Avoid abrasive scrubbing that can damage the finish.
What is the lifespan of a vinyl fence?
The lifespan of a vinyl fence is typically 20–30 years, depending on material quality and maintenance. Exposure to extreme sunlight or harsh weather can reduce longevity. Regular cleaning and avoiding physical damage can extend its usable life. Higher-grade vinyl tends to last longer than cheaper alternatives.
